Output 17e0c95f8e8768c16255be7c4e5c77d9604e03e0d8d92c68682945664ad63ebe:7

value
1047566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04582388b2f6ba1d7e63b1415fd46f8792045d59 OP_EQUAL
address
325zDJW8npYSXB1cTk1CuTtYYP4xLuw8Aq
transaction
17e0c95f8e8768c16255be7c4e5c77d9604e03e0d8d92c68682945664ad63ebe
spent
true